概括
分子动力学模拟揭示了像胆固醇和PIP2这样的脂质如何与SLC4二碳酸盐载体相互作用. 这些相互作用对传送器功能,形状变化和二元化至关重要.

背景情况:
- 二次活性载体的SLC4家族通过运输二碳酸盐和其他离子,在pH和离子稳态中发挥着至关重要的作用.
- 脂质与SLC4载体的相互作用,特别是AE1和NBCe1,被认为会影响它们的功能,但对其他成员和构造的理解仍然很差.
- 之前的研究强调了胆固醇 (CHOL) 和酸二酸盐 (PIP2) 与AE1的相互作用,但在SLC4家族中缺乏更广泛的理解.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究脂质和三个关键的SLC4家族成员之间的相互作用:AE1,NBCe1和NDCBE,在不同的结构状态.
- 确定特定的脂质结合位点,并了解它们在SLC4载体功能,形状转换和二元化中的潜在调节作用.
主要方法:
- 在模型HEK293细胞膜中使用AE1,NBCe1和NDCBE的粗粒和原子分子动力学模拟.
- 模拟了AE1的面向外的和面向内的状态,以捕捉不同的功能构造.
- 利用ProLint服务器进行脂质-蛋白质接触分析,以确定增强相互作用的区域和假定的脂质结合点.
主要成果:
- 在所有三个研究的SLC4载体周围观察到胆固醇 (CHOL) 和酸二酸 (PIP2) 的持续丰富.
- 根据蛋白质类型和构造状态检测到脂质分布的微妙差异,表明特定的脂质-蛋白质相互作用.
- 在AE1,NBCe1和NDCBE的结构中确定了CHOL,PIP2,甲醇和甲醇的假定结合点.
结论:
- 胆固醇和PIP2在不同SLC4家族成员的功能和调节中起着重要作用.
- 鉴定到的脂质结合部位表明,SLC4载体活性,形态动力学和二元化的脂质介导调节的潜在机制.
- 这项研究为进一步研究脂质与SLC4载体之间的复杂关系提供了基础,这对于维持细胞平衡至关重要.
